Senior Bear golfer Will Van Pelt qualified for the 4A Region III Regional Golf Tournament this Wednesday at the 22-4A District Golf Tournament.
Van Pelt fired an 86 Monday and followed that with a round of 90 Tuesday to post a two-day total of 176. Van Pelt finished 7th overall individually and posted the best score outside of the top two teams advancing to grab one of two individual qualifier spots in the Regional tournament.
Junior Gavin Laffitte just missed out on the second Regional individual qualifier spot, losing in a playoff to Conner McCollum of Lumberton. Laffitte finished with an 89-89/178, Lance Hodkinson shot a 108-109/217, Jacob Johnson posted a 113-125/238, and Zade Roy finished with a 136-119/255.
The Bears shot a team score of 803 to finish 4th in the team standings behind Champion Orangefield (680), 2nd place Bridge City (688), and 3rd place Lumberton (801).
